Output e6d6008003204e6faa31d8a7f1eac5f4d3caa4f040d0bba6df8ca93493e17b44:1

value
24996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7807e906fbfa1b3c0cbc32e0abf6a684f0d4746 OP_EQUAL
address
3KstKfWn86486TNBcFvFLSeux9qcuyxmxo
transaction
e6d6008003204e6faa31d8a7f1eac5f4d3caa4f040d0bba6df8ca93493e17b44
spent
true